  13) Canvas housekeeping

  After each bread session, if you have used canvas, brush it thoroughly to remove all traces of flour and hang it out to dry before putting away. Otherwise the canvas could become moldy and ruin your next batch of dough.

  DELAYED ACTION

  Starting and stopping the dough process

  As noted in the Master Recipe, there are numerous points at which you can slow down the action or stop it altogether, by setting the dough in a colder place, or refrigerating or freezing it. Exact timings for any of these delaying procedures are impossible to give because so much depends on what has taken place during the slow-down, how cold the dough is when it starts to rise again, and so forth. All you need to remember is that you are in complete control: you can always push down a partially risen dough; you can slow the action with cold; you can speed it with warmth. You will work out your own systems and the following chart will help you:

  TO DELAY THE FIRST RISING, SET DOUGH IN A COLDER PLACE

  Approximate Hours of Rise at Degrees F.

  5–6 65

  7–8 55

  9–10 Refrigerator

  TO STOP ACTION ALTOGETHER AFTER FIRST OR SECOND RISE

  Deflate, wrap airtight, and freeze. Limit: A week to 10 days, probably more for plain French bread dough, and risky after 10 days for doughs with butter and eggs. (We shall not venture farther upon this uncertain limb.)

  TO DELAY SECOND RISING

  a) Set dough in a colder place.

  b) Set a plate on top of dough and a 5-lb. weight; refrigerate.

  TO DELAY OR FREEZE AFTER DOUGH IS FORMED

  a) Set dough in a colder place.

  b) Form dough on lightly oiled sheet; cover airtight and refrigerate or freeze, but note preceding time limit.

  TO START ACTION AFTER THAWING

  a) Thaw overnight in refrigerator; complete the rise at room temperature.

  b) Set at 80 degrees until thawed; complete the rise at room temperature.

  VARIATIONS

  Other Forms for French Bread

  Long thin loaves (ficelles, baked size: 12 to 16 by 1½ inches)

  Cut the original dough, Step 5, into 5 or 6 pieces and form as illustrated in the recipe, but making thinner sausage shapes about ½ inch in diameter. When they have risen, slash as illustrated, Step 9.

  Oval rolls (petits pains, tire-bouchons)

  Cut the dough into 10 or 12 pieces and form like bâtards, but you will probably not have to lengthen them at all after the two foldings and sealings. When they have risen, make either 2 parallel slashes, or a single slash going from one end to the other.

  Round loaves (pain de ménage, miches, boules)

  When you want bread for big sandwiches or for toast, a big round loaf is attractive. The object here is to force the cloak of coagulated gluten to hold the ball of dough in shape: the first movement will make a cushion; the second will seal and round the ball, establishing surface tension. To begin the process, after the risen dough has been cut and has rested 5 minutes, Step 5, place it on a lightly floured surface.

  Lift the left side of the dough with the side of your left hand and bring it down almost to the other side.

  Scoop up that side and push it back almost to the left side. Revolve dough a quarter turn clockwise and repeat the movement eight to ten times. This movement gradually smooths the bottom of the dough and establishes the necessary surface tension; think of the surface of the dough as if it were a fine sheet of rubber you were stretching in every direction.

  Then turn the dough smooth side up and begin rotating it between the palms of your hands, tucking a bit of the dough under the ball as you rotate it. In a dozen turns you should have a neatly shaped ball with a little pucker of dough, la clé, underneath where the edges have all joined together.

  Place the dough pucker side up on flour-rubbed canvas; seal the pucker by pinching with your fingers. Flour lightly, cover loosely, and let rise to almost triple its size. After unmolding upside down on the baking sheet, slash it as follows:

  Large loaves are usually slashed in a cross: make one vertical slash and complete the horizontal cuts as illustrated. Medium loaves may have a cross, a single central slash, or a semicircular slash around half the circumference.

  Round rolls (petits pains, champignons)

  Cut the original dough, Step 5, into 10 to 12 pieces. After they have rested 5 minutes, form them one at a time, leaving the rest of the dough covered. The principles are the same here as for the preceding round loaves, but make the preliminary cushion shape with your fingers rather than the palms of your hands.

  For the second stage, during which the ball of dough is rotated smooth side up, roll it under the palm of one hand, using your thumb and little finger to push the edges of the dough underneath and to form the pucker, where the edges join together.

  Place the formed ball of dough pucker side up on the flour-rubbed canvas and cover loosely while forming the rest. Space the balls 2 inches apart. When risen to almost triple its size, lift gently with lightly floured fingers and place pucker side down on baking sheet. Rolls are usually too small for a cross; make either one central slash or the semicircular cut.

  THE SIMULATED BAKER’S OVEN

  Baking in the ordinary way, as described in the preceding recipe, produces an acceptable loaf of bread, but does not nearly approach the glory you can achieve when you turn your home oven into a baker’s oven. Merely providing yourself with the proper amount of steam, if you do nothing else, will vastly improve the crust, the color, the slash patterns, and the volume of your bread; steam is only a matter of plopping a heated brick or stone into a pan of water in the bottom of the oven. The second provision is a hot surface upon which the naked dough can bake; this gives that added push of volume that improves both the appearance and the slash patterns. When you have the hot baking surface, you will then also need a paddle or board upon which you can transfer dough from canvas to hot baking surface. For the complete setup, here is what you should have, and any building-supply store stocks these items.

  For the hot baking surface

  Metal will not do as a hot baking surface because it burns the bottom of the dough. The most practical and easily obtainable substance is ordinary red floor tiles ¼ inch thick. They come in various sizes such as 6 by 6 inches, 6 by 3 inches, and you need only enough to line the surface of an oven rack. Look them up under Tiles in your directory, and ask for “quarry tiles,” their official name.

  For unmolding the risen dough from its canvas

  A piece of 3⁄16-inch plywood about 20 inches long and 8 inches wide.

  For sliding the dough onto the hot asbestos

  When you are doing 3 long loaves, you must slide them together onto the hot asbestos; to do so you unmold them one at a time from the canvas with one board and arrange them side by side on the second board, which takes the place of the baker’s wooden paddle, la pelle. Buy a piece of 3⁄16-inch plywood slightly longer but 2 inches narrower than your oven rack.

  To prevent dough from sticking to unmolding and sliding boards

  White cornmeal or small pasta pulverized in the electric blender until it is the consistency of table salt. This is called fleurage.

  The steam contraption

  Something that you can heat to sizzling hot on top of the stove and then slide into a pan of water in the oven to make a great burst of steam: a brick, a solid 10-lb. rock, piece of cast iron or other metal. A 9 × 12-inch roasting pan 2 inches deep to hold an inch of water and the hot brick.

  Nonessential professional equipment

  Instead of letting the formed dough rise on canvas, sur couche, many French bakers place each piece in a canvas-lined wicker or plastic form called a banneton; from this you turn the risen dough upside down directly onto a board and then slide it into the oven. Various sizes and shapes are available in French bakery-supply houses.

  USING THE SIMULATED BAKER’S OVEN

  At least 30 to 40 minutes before the end of the final rise, Step 7 in the Master Recipe, line the rack of your oven with quarry tiles, slide onto upper-third level, and preheat oven to 450 degrees. At the same time set the brick or metal over very high heat on top of the stove so that it will get sizzling hot, the hotter the better.

  Provide yourself with 2 stiff spoons or spatulas, or with fire tongs for lifting brick from stove top into pan of water in bottom of oven when the time comes, and test lifting the brick to be sure you have the instruments to do the job. NOTE: You may use a spray bottle rather than a brick; it works reasonably well though less dramatically.

  When the final rise is complete, sprinkle pulverized cornmeal or pasta on the long side of the unmolding board and on the surface of the sliding board. Your object now is to unmold the loaves one at a time from the canvas to the sliding board, then to slide the 3 of them together onto the hot tiles in the oven. Place the long side of board at one side of the dough, then raise and flip the dough softly upside down onto board.

  Slip the dough, still upside down, from the unmolding board onto the right side of the sliding board. Line up the rest of the dough side by side in the same manner.

  Slash the dough as described in Step 9.

  Place pan of cold water on the lowest rack of an electric oven, or on the floor of a gas oven, add sizzling hot brick, and close oven door.

  The 3 pieces of dough are now to be slid together off the sliding board onto the hot tiles in the oven: the movement is one quick, smooth jerk like that old magician’s trick of pulling the cloth from under a tableful of dishes. Open the oven and, holding the sliding board at the two ends nearest you, rapidly extend your arms so the far end of the board rests on the far end of the asbestos at the back of the oven. Then with one quick jerk, pull the board toward you and the three loaves will slide off onto the tiles. This must be a fast and confident action because if you pause midway, the dough will rumple off the board and once it touches the hot tiles you cannot move or reshape it, although it will come loose after 5 to 6 minutes of baking. You may muff this every once in a while, and produce some queerly deformed shapes, but they will all bake into bread.

  Remove the brick and pan of water after 5 to 8 minutes of baking; the crust will have started to brown lightly. The oven should be dry for the rest of the baking. Total baking time will be about 25 minutes for bâtards; the bread is done when it makes a hollow thump if tapped, and when the crust is crisp and, hopefully, nicely browned.

  SELF-CRITICISM—OR HOW TO IMPROVE THE PRODUCT

  Certainly one of the fascinating aspects of cooking is that you can almost endlessly improve upon what you have done, and when you realize that professional bakers have spent years learning their trade it would be surprising indeed if your first loaves were perfect in every respect. If they seem below standard in any of the following points, here are some possible explanations.

  Crust did not brown

  If you have not used the hot brick and pan of water steam-contraption, you will not get a very brown crust. Or if you have used the brick, perhaps it was not really sizzling hot; heat it 15 minutes longer the next time, or use 2 bricks. On the other hand, your oven thermostat might be inaccurate, and the oven was not really at the required 450 degrees. A third possibility is that your dough might have been under-salted; check your measurements carefully in Step 1 the next time.

  Crust was too brown or too red

  If you were using the brick system, you might have had too much steam in the oven; next time use a smaller brick, or heat it a little less, or take it out several minutes sooner. Another possibility is that the dough mixture in Step 1 got an overdose of salt, and salt affects color; next time be sure your teaspoons are level.

  Crust was tough

  A tough crust is usually due to humidity: the day was damp and sticky, or your kitchen was steamy, and the starch has coagulated and hardened on the surface of the dough.

  Slashes did not bulge open in the crust

  Go over the instructions in Step 9 to check on whether you cut them as directed. On the other hand, it might be that the bread had over-risen in Step 7, just before baking, and the yeast had no strength left for its final push in the oven. Conversely, you might not have let it rise enough in this step and the dough was too heavy to bulge out the way it should.

  Bread seems heavy; no holes inside

  This is always due to insufficient rising, particularly during the pre-bake rise in Step 7. Next time be sure it feels light and springy, and looks swollen, and that it has risen to almost triple its original size before it goes into the oven.

  Flavor is uninteresting

  Again, the only reason for this is insufficient time taken for rising: the yeast has not had an opportunity to produce the slow aging and maturing that develops flavor. For your next batch, follow the timing and temperature requirements particularly in Step 3, for the first rise.

  Flavor is unpleasantly yeasty or sour

  A yeasty over-fermented smell and taste are due more often to the dough having risen at too high a temperature than to its having over-risen. Next time, watch the room temperature at which it is rising, and if you are making bread in hot weather, you will have to take a longer time and let it rise in the refrigerator.

  MACHINE MIXING AND KNEADING OF FRENCH BREAD DOUGH

  French bread dough is too soft to work in the electric food processor, but the heavy-duty mixer with dough hook, illustrated in the equipment section at the end of the book, works perfectly. The dough-hook attachment that comes with some hand-held electric mixers and the hand-cranking bread pails are slower and less efficient, to our mind, than hand kneading. In any case, when you are using electricity, follow the steps in the recipe as outlined, including the rests; do not over-knead, and for the heavy-duty mixer, do not go over a moderate speed of number 3 or 4, or you risk breaking down the gluten in the dough. When the kneading is finished, take the dough out of the bowl and give it a minute or so of hand kneading, just to be sure it is smooth and elastic throughout. Then proceed with the recipe as usual, from Step 3 on.

  PAIN DE MIE

  [White Sandwich Bread—for sandwiches, canapés, toast, and croûtons]

  It is almost impossible in present-day America to find the firm, close-grained, evenly rectangular, unsliced type of white bread that is essential for professional-looking canapés, appetizers, and fancy sandwiches. In French this is pain de mie, meaning that the mie, the crumb or inside, is more important than the crust; in fact the crust exists merely as a thin and easily sliced covering. French boulangeries form and bake the bread in special covered molds; the bread rises during baking so that it fills the mold completely and emerges absolutely symmetrical. The form can be round or cylindrical, but it is usually rectangular. You can easily achieve the round or the rectangular shapes by baking in any straight-sided bread pan or baking dish, covering the pan with foil and a baking sheet, and topping that with some kind of weight to keep the bread from pushing up out of shape while it is in the oven.

  For about 1 pound of flour, making 3 cups of dough, to fill one 8-cup covered pan or two 4-cup covered pans

  1) The preliminary dough mixture—le fraisage. Either by hand:

  1 cake (0.6 ounce) fresh yeast, or 1 package dry-active yeast

  3 Tb warm water (not over 100 degrees) in a measure

  2 tsp salt

  1⅓ cups tepid milk in a measure

  3½ cups unbleached all-purpose flour (scooped and leveled)

  A 4- to 5-quart bowl with fairly straight sides

  A rubber spatula, and a pastry scraper or stiff metal blade

  Mix the yeast in the warm water and let it liquefy completely while measuring out the rest of the ingredients. Dissolve the salt in the tepid milk. Measure the flour into the mixing bowl. Then stir in the liquefied yeast and salted milk with a rubber spatula, cutting and pressing the dough firmly togethe
r into a mass, being sure all bits of flour and unblended pieces are gathered in. Turn dough out onto a flat kneading surface, scraping bowl clean. Dough will be quite soft and sticky; let it rest for 2 to 3 minutes while you wash and dry the bowl.

  2) Kneading—pétrissage

  Start kneading by lifting the near side of the dough, using a scraper or spatula to help you, and flipping it over onto the other side. Scrape dough off surface and slap down again; lift, flip over and slap down again, repeating the movement rapidly.

  In 2 to 3 minutes dough should have enough body so that you can give it a quick forward push with the heel of your hand as you flip it over. If it remains too sticky for this, knead in a sprinkling of flour. When it begins to clean itself off the working surface and draw back into shape, it is ready for the next step—kneading in the butter.
